The Giants hold the 3rd general choice in the 2025 NFL Draft.

It is the eighth time in the last 11 years that the Giants will select inside the top 10, and the 6th time since 2018 that the G-Men will pick inside the leading 6.

That isn't the sort of pattern that any NFL franchise wants, but it is where the Giants are right now.

The silver lining is that they have the opportunity to draft a franchise cornerstone at Lambeau Field on Thursday night.

Oddsmakers believe that gamer will be Abdul Carter, the stud defensive end out of Penn State.

BetMGM Sportsbook had Carter at -450 to go third overall on April 17, sports betting but has actually because seen his chances reduce to -600. That cost carries an implied likelihood of 85.7 percent.

Travis Hunter is the 2nd preferred to go to the Giants at No. 3 overall at +400.

Hunter is now a frustrating preferred to go to the Browns at No. 2, however there is an outdoors opportunity that Cleveland chooses quarterback Shedeur Sanders in that spot instead.

If that happens, the Giants might opt for Hunter, a two-way star out of Colorado, instead.

For many of the 2024 season, it appeared like an inevitable conclusion that the Giants would target a quarterback in this position, however basic manager Joe Schoen signed Russell Wilson and Jameis Winston in the offseason and has hinted the team likely will not be picking a signal-caller at No. 3.

The odds on Carter at this moment are too brief to get included in, but if you're searching for a fun Giants-related bet you can bet on there to be some turmoil in Round 1 with a little play on Sanders (22/1) to go No. 2 general, and then Hunter (4/1) to go to Big Blue at No. 3.

It's worth keeping in mind that this is a long shot, so it's not likely to win, but I 'd rather sprinkle something little on this course than lay severe juice on Carter, given that there is a way this goes sideways.
